Featured Snippet Opportunity: What Does "Luxury Safari" Actually Mean? A luxury safari typically involves high-end accommodations (often exclusive-use villas or boutique camps), private or semi-private game drives, gourmet dining, personalized service, and unique experiential elements (e.g., walking safaris, hot air balloon rides, cultural visits). It emphasizes comfort, exclusivity, and profound immersion, often with a strong focus on responsible tourism and conservation efforts.

The Best Destinations for African Safari Luxury
When one thinks of an African safari luxury, a few names naturally spring to mind. Each offers something distinct:
- Tanzania: Home to the great wildebeest migration, especially in the Serengeti and Ngorongoro Crater. The sheer density of wildlife here, particularly during migration season, is simply phenomenal. It’s a classic for a reason. For insights into ethical travel, consider resources like the World Wide Fund for Nature, which often touches on responsible tourism in wildlife-rich areas.
- Kenya: Often combined with Tanzania, Kenya’s Masai Mara offers a similar, incredible migration experience and vibrant Maasai culture. Amboseli provides iconic elephant views against Kilimanjaro.
- Botswana: Known for its low-density tourism model, offering incredibly exclusive and private safari tours, especially in the Okavango Delta and Chobe National Park. This tends to be at the higher end of the luxury safari vacations spectrum, truly.
- South Africa: Offers a diverse range, from the iconic Kruger National Park (and its private reserves like Sabi Sands for ultimate luxury) to malaria-free safaris ideal for families.
The choice largely depends on what kind of experience you're chasing. Are you after the drama of the migration, or perhaps the serene tranquility of a water-based safari in Botswana?
Is a Private Safari Tour Really Worth the Investment?
This is a common question, and frankly, a very valid one given the investment. The short answer? For many, absolutely. When you embark on private safari tours, you gain unparalleled flexibility. Your schedule dictates the game drives, not a group. Want to stay out longer watching a lion pride? You can. Prefer to head back for an early lunch? That's fine too.
This personalized approach extends to the guides, who can tailor their knowledge and focus precisely to your interests. It makes the experience significantly more intimate and, dare I say, profound. Think of it as having your own expert, dedicated solely to enhancing your wildlife viewing and overall enjoyment.
